### Refactor: retire legacy ORM layer in Thornquist

Replaces the old Mapwright ORM with the new query builder across billing and inventory modules. No schema changes. Query plans verified identical except two N+1 fixes. Connection pooling moves into the builder, so the old per-model pool settings are gone. Rollback is a single revert. The pool and timeout constants now live in one place, shown below.

tuning table, tafog-hadug:
THRESHOLDS = {
    "novath": 282,
    "ulaok": 770,
    "julath": 545,
    "keliel": 909,
    "joreth": 37,
}

Hey Marisol — quiet week on Gridwright, mostly. The crossword generator choked twice on oversized themed puzzles; I bumped the solver timeout and it's been fine since. One open ticket about duplicate clues in the Sunday batch, low priority. Dashboard alerts are all green. If anything blows up with the clue database, ping Tobin's team first thing. You can reach them directly here.

pager mailbox: sormir@qirvanworks.corp

All requests to Dispatchly must be authenticated; unauthenticated calls are rejected and logged. As a contractor you won't have a personal account, so use the shared service credential for the sandbox environment only. Production access requires a separate review. Configure the credential as an environment variable before running the assignment simulator, otherwise every scoring run will fail on startup. The sandbox key is as follows.

service key, fawip-bajef: kto11_Qt5wZK9vdNC

Wiki (Managers Only) — Marketing Budget Reduction, Pellbright Foods

The marketing budget is reduced by 18% for the remainder of the year. Trade-show presence in Westrum is cancelled; the Savoury Select campaign continues at reduced spend. Sales leads should adjust lead-generation expectations accordingly and route co-marketing requests through Dorit Ashvane. The confidential reasoning behind this reduction is recorded below.

management briefing: Project Ulavan slips by two quarters because of the staffing delay.